These high school kids dance the night away for THON (PHOTOS)

They were hopping and bobbing and dancing the night away.

The student body of Notre Dame High School started at 5:30 p.m. Friday and planned to keep moving until 5:30 p.m. Saturday in the newly renovated gymnasium at their high school in Bethlehem Township.

Included in the event was a road trip to watch the girls basketball team take on Southern Lehigh in the Colonial League finals. The large, colorful group stayed its feet for the entire game.

Notre Dame High School dance for a cause during the 2017 MiniTHON

This is the ninth year Notre Dame is taking part in the largest student philanthropy in the world, the Penn State IFC/PHC Dance Marathon (THON).

All proceeds benefit the Four Diamonds Fund, conquering childhood cancer, at the Hershey Medical Center in Hershey, Pa.

Notre Dame Student Council hosted its first MiniTHON in November 2008. The 81 dancers then aised more than $16,000 for the Four Diamonds Fund, school officials said.

This year about 350 students are participating, with a total of more than 2,000 dancers raising close to $400,000 just at Notre Dame in the past eight years. Notre Dame is also one of only two high schools out of more than 250 to hold its miniTHON for a full 24 hours, organizers said.

The event will culminate in the last hour when dancers change from their colored team shirts into black shirts, uniting the group to spend the last hour celebrating their achievement. Finally, the last ten seconds are counted down, and the dancers are allowed to sit for the first time in a day.

As a finale, students will reveal the fundraising total, just as the dancers at Penn State will at the conclusion of their THON this weekend.
